Paris, France

The perfect 4 days itinerary

Paris, the capital of France, is globally renowned for its art, fashion, gastronomy, and culture. Its 19th-century cityscape is crisscrossed by wide boulevards and the River Seine. Beyond such landmarks as the Eiffel Tower and the 12th-century, Gothic Notre-Dame cathedral, the city is known for its cafe culture and designer boutiques along the Rue du Faubourg Saint-Honoré. Paris is also home to some of the world's most visited museums, including the Louvre and the Musée d'Orsay.

What to do in Paris?

This 4 days itinerary is the perfect guide to the best things to see in Paris. It includes day-by-day activities, travel tips, and the top places to visit.

Day 1: Iconic Landmarks and Historical Wonders

Morning

Start your day with a visit to the iconic Eiffel Tower. Climb up to the top for a breathtaking view of the city. After descending, stroll along the Champ de Mars, a large public greenspace that is perfect for a picnic.

Afternoon

Head to the Louvre Museum, the world's largest art museum and a historic monument in Paris. Spend the afternoon exploring ancient and Renaissance art, including the famous Mona Lisa.

Evening

Enjoy a dinner cruise on the River Seine, where you can see many of Paris's most famous sights illuminated at night.


Day 2: Art and Culture in the Heart of Paris

Morning

Visit the Musée d'Orsay, renowned for its impressive collection of Impressionist and Post-Impressionist masterpieces. Walk across the Pont Alexandre III, one of the most ornate and extravagant bridges in the city.

Afternoon

Explore the Montmartre district, known for its artists' studios and bohemian vibe. Visit the Basilica of the Sacré-Cœur, situated at the summit of Montmartre, offering panoramic views of Paris.

Evening

Dine in one of Montmartre's charming bistros before enjoying a show at the famous Moulin Rouge.


Day 3: A Day of Luxury and Fashion

Morning

Start your day in the opulent Opera Garnier, an architectural masterpiece. Then, indulge in some shopping at the Galeries Lafayette, a famous upscale shopping center.

Afternoon

Continue your shopping spree along the Rue du Faubourg Saint-Honoré, known for its high-end boutiques and fashion houses. Visit the Place Vendôme, a square renowned for its luxurious jewelry shops.

Evening

Relax at a chic café in the Marais district, known for its vibrant nightlife and stylish boutiques.


Day 4: Exploring Parisian History and Green Spaces

Morning

Visit the Notre-Dame Cathedral, an iconic example of Gothic architecture. Walk to the nearby Île Saint-Louis, one of two natural islands in the Seine, known for its quiet streets and quaint shops.

Afternoon

Explore the Luxembourg Gardens, a beautiful example of French garden design. Visit the Panthéon, a mausoleum containing the remains of distinguished French citizens.

Evening

Conclude your trip with a relaxing evening at a local café, reflecting on the beautiful experiences of the past few days.
